]> granicus.if.org Git - curl/commitdiff
curl_easy_setopt.3: add CURL_HTTP_VERSION_2_0
authorFabian Frank <fabian@pagefault.de>
Tue, 11 Feb 2014 07:29:21 +0000 (23:29 -0800)
committerDaniel Stenberg <daniel@haxx.se>
Tue, 11 Feb 2014 21:55:49 +0000 (22:55 +0100)
docs/libcurl/curl_easy_setopt.3

index bb53a423295937dac1bca3aef3a43252ea972fa4..9a189647107ee13dd8a7c5fd01dbbb73163be899 100644 (file)
@@ -1619,7 +1619,8 @@ When setting \fICURLOPT_HTTPGET\fP to 1, it will automatically set
 .IP CURLOPT_HTTP_VERSION
 Pass a long, set to one of the values described below. They force libcurl to
 use the specific HTTP versions. This is not sensible to do unless you have a
-good reason.
+good reason. You have to set this option if you want to use libcurl's HTTP 2.0
+support.
 .RS
 .IP CURL_HTTP_VERSION_NONE
 We don't care about what version the library uses. libcurl will use whatever
@@ -1628,6 +1629,9 @@ it thinks fit.
 Enforce HTTP 1.0 requests.
 .IP CURL_HTTP_VERSION_1_1
 Enforce HTTP 1.1 requests.
+.IP CURL_HTTP_VERSION_2_0
+Attempt HTTP 2.0 requests. libcurl will fall back to HTTP 1.x if HTTP 2.0
+can't be negotiated with the server.
 .RE
 .IP CURLOPT_IGNORE_CONTENT_LENGTH
 Ignore the Content-Length header. This is useful for Apache 1.x (and similar